Casa Rinconada is the largest Great Kiva in Chaco Culture National Historical Park, located near Nageezi, New Mexico. Built about 1050 AD, great kivas were used as places of public ceremony by the Ancestral Puebloans. Great kivas were always aligned to the cardinal directions. In the case of Casa Rinconada, a window pointing towards the northeast catches the sunlight at summer solstice sunrise and illuminates a niche in the kiva's circular masonry wall. |
